Hunter Allen Bio:

Hunter Allen, ex-pro cyclist, coach and author has recently authored “Training and Competing with a Continuous Glucose Monitor”.   Hunter is best known for his work with power meters and for developing the power training principles.  He’s the co-author of “Training and Racing with a Power Meter”, along with “Cutting Edge Cycling” and “Triathlon: Training with Power”.   Hunter was one of the co-developers of TrainingPeaks WKO software and a co-founder of TrainingPeaks.  He founded and currently operates The Peaks Coaching Group.

Key Ideas:

  • Managing blood glucose is not only important for health and longevity, it impacts athletic performance in real time
  • Wearing a CGM provides access to the raw data needed to manage glucose via diet, feed schedule, activity
  • For athletic performance, keeping blood glucose in the high performance zone means no bonking or premature fatigue.
